Combine Resources for an Out-of-this-World Astronomy Unit
Pairing resources that take very different approaches to sharing similar information can be a very effective teaching tactic. For example, you might pair the titles in the Our Universe series of books for beginning readers—which includes The Solar System, The Night Sky, Earth, Mars, and Moon—with my lyrical picture book The Stuff of Stars—and the resources found at NASA’s Space Place website. Together, they’ll make for a great STEM unit on space for early readers.
